Understanding the Technology Behind Water Soluble Packaging Machines
Water soluble packaging machines represent a fusion of advanced engineering and environmentally responsible materials science. These machines are designed to process specialized water soluble films and convert them into packaging solutions that dissolve harmlessly upon contact with water. The core technology involves precise heat and pressure controls that ensure the packaging is formed in a sturdy yet dissolvable state, suitable for various product types ranging from powders to liquids.
The materials used most commonly are polyvinyl alcohol (PVOH) films, which can be engineered to dissolve at specific rates depending on temperature and water conditions. The packaging machines must handle these films delicately since their dissolvability is both a feature and a potential challenge during manufacturing. Advanced sensors and automated controls maintain ideal environmental parameters such as humidity and temperature within the machinery to prevent premature dissolution.
Processing speed and accuracy are critical features of water soluble packaging machines. Unlike traditional packaging, these machines must ensure tight sealing to prevent moisture ingress before consumer use, which requires high precision. The machinery often includes various modes to accommodate different packaging sizes and shapes, making it versatile for use across multiple industries.
Additionally, these machines integrate with smart manufacturing systems, allowing real-time monitoring and data collection. This ensures product consistency and minimizes waste. Maintenance protocols differ slightly from conventional packaging machines due to the delicate nature of water soluble films, but advancements in design have made these machines increasingly user-friendly and cost-effective over time.
Environmental Benefits and Sustainability Impact
One of the most compelling reasons companies are turning to water soluble packaging machines is the significant environmental benefits they offer. Traditional plastic packaging has long been criticized for its non-biodegradable nature and the burden it places on landfills and marine environments. In contrast, water soluble packaging dissolves completely, leaving no toxic residues behind, thereby mitigating pollution dramatically.
The adoption of water soluble packaging solutions helps reduce the volume of persistent plastic waste, contributing to lower carbon footprints for manufacturers. Since these materials decompose quickly, they also alleviate soil contamination and protect aquatic ecosystems, a critical concern in contemporary environmental policies worldwide.
Moreover, the use of water soluble packaging aligns seamlessly with corporate sustainability goals and helps brands demonstrate their commitment to environmental stewardship. Consumers are increasingly favoring eco-conscious brands, making these packaging machines not only environmentally sound but also a strategic business investment.
In addition to reducing waste, water soluble packaging is often lighter than traditional plastic packaging, which leads to energy savings during transport and storage. The cumulative effect results in lower greenhouse gas emissions associated with the supply chain. Companies can leverage these benefits in marketing strategies to appeal to the growing demographic of environmentally aware consumers who demand transparency and responsibility.
From a regulatory standpoint, numerous governments and international bodies are implementing stricter rules on plastic use and waste management. Water soluble packaging presents a proactive solution, helping businesses stay compliant with evolving standards and avoid potential penalties or restrictions.
Versatile Applications Across Multiple Industries
The versatility of water soluble packaging machines makes them suitable for a wide array of industries, each benefiting uniquely from the technology. In the pharmaceutical sector, these machines are revolutionizing the way medications and supplements are packaged. Water soluble sachets can encase powders, granules, or capsules, providing a safe, tamper-evident packaging option that dissolves tautly with water consumption, enhancing patient convenience and adherence to dosage.
In the food industry, water soluble packaging machines contribute to increased sustainability while offering practical benefits such as portion control and easier product preparation. Single-use items like detergent pods, seasoning sachets, or instant drink mixes benefit immensely. The dissolvable packaging eliminates the need for unwrapping or disposing of traditional packaging waste, speeding up consumer routines and reducing waste at home and commercial kitchens.
Agriculture is another key area where this packaging innovation shines. Water soluble films can encase fertilizers, pesticides, or seeds, protecting the contents until application. Upon dissolution, they release nutrients or chemicals efficiently without excess packaging waste, simplifying processes for farmers and reducing environmental runoff concerns.
Industrial cleaning products, personal care items, and even textiles have found synergies with water soluble packaging machines. The ability to customize film thickness, dissolution time, and packaging shape allows manufacturers to tailor product delivery to very specific user needs, enhancing overall product performance and consumer satisfaction.
The adaptability of these machines extends further due to technological customization options, enabling companies to produce packaging compatible with temperature-sensitive or moisture-sensitive goods, broadening their application horizons.
Challenges and Considerations When Implementing Water Soluble Packaging
While the benefits of water soluble packaging are impressive, companies contemplating integration of these machines should be aware of potential challenges to prepare adequately. One of the primary considerations is the cost of materials; water soluble films can be more expensive than conventional plastic films. This initial investment can affect product pricing unless efficiencies are gained elsewhere in the production or supply chain.
The sensitivity of the packaging material requires stringent environmental controls during storage and handling, both in manufacturing plants and warehouses. Excess humidity or moisture exposure before use can compromise packaging integrity, leading to spoilage or customer dissatisfaction. Therefore, companies may need to invest in improved climate control solutions or modified logistics protocols.
Consumer education is another important factor. Since water soluble packaging is relatively new in many markets, some customers may be unfamiliar with its handling and disposal. Clear instructions for use and disposal need to be communicated effectively to maximize product benefits and minimize misuse or misunderstanding.
Moreover, the mechanical complexity of water soluble packaging machines means maintenance and operational expertise are critical to avoid downtime. Technical support and operator training programs must be budgeted for successful long-term deployment.
Finally, compatibility with all product types is not universal. Some moisture-sensitive products or those requiring extremely long shelf lives may not be ideal candidates for water soluble packaging. Thorough product testing and analysis are necessary before fully shifting packaging systems.
Future Trends and Innovations in Water Soluble Packaging Technology
The future of water soluble packaging machines looks bright, driven by ongoing advancements in materials science, automation, and sustainability demands. Research is continuously improving the properties of water soluble films, aiming for enhanced strength, faster or slower dissolution rates depending on application needs, and even embedding functionalities like antimicrobial agents or nutrient release mechanisms.
Automation and AI integration will further streamline production, enabling smarter machines capable of self-diagnosing issues and optimizing packaging parameters in real-time. This will reduce waste, energy consumption, and maintenance costs, making the technology even more attractive to manufacturers worldwide.
Collaboration with biodegradable inks and coatings will expand the fully compostable and eco-friendly packaging concept, pushing the boundaries beyond water solubility to a holistic sustainable packaging ecosystem. These innovations will allow brands to meet upcoming regulatory frameworks that could demand zero plastic waste and carbon neutrality.
Additionally, partnerships between packaging machine manufacturers and raw material producers will likely enhance material availability, reducing costs and increasing adoption rates. There may also be developments in recycling processes that utilize water soluble materials in new ways, contributing to circular economy models.
Consumer demand for convenience combined with environmental responsibility will continue to fuel investments in this sector. As public awareness grows and technology matures, water soluble packaging machines are set to become a standard feature in product manufacturing across the globe.
